       How do we recycle Styrofoam? First, some background information:
       Technically, Styrofoam is the trademarked insulation foam
       produced by the Dow Chemical Company, but the word “styrofoam”
       commonly refers to expanded polystyrene (EPS) foam.
       EPS is rigid foam often found in packaging and take-away
       containers. Environmentally, Styrofoam is one of the most
       frustrating materials we encounter. It takes more than 1 million
       years for a Styrofoam food container to decompose and it is
       often not cost effective to recycle. So, environmentally, the
       best course of action is to avoid buying products with Styrofoam
       packaging and to avoid purchasing items online that must be
       packaged and shipped to you. There are some potential
       replacements for Styrofoam in the works, but they are still a
       little ways off.
